Carbon Steel A334 Gr 6 Tubing is made up of a combination of iron and carbon, creating an alloy with a temperature range of -328 degrees to 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it. This tubing also contains trace amounts of manganese, phosphorus, sulfur and silicon. These small additions to the base components greatly enhance the strength and durability of the tubing, allowing it to sustain extreme levels of heat during different applications. It is instrumental in thermal power plants that need steel pipes capable of handling significant temperature changes. The chemical composition of A334 Gr 6 Carbon Steel Tubing makes it an incredibly versatile material for various construction needs.

Carbon Steel Tubing A334 Gr 6 is an ideal choice for various applications due to its versatile properties. Its uses include heat exchanges, condenser tubes and pressure vessels. Its strength and toughness make it an excellent choice for such tasks. The carbon content provides exceptional machinability and weldability. It also offers good corrosion resistance, making it suitable for outdoor applications. With its reliable architecture, Carbon Steel A334 Gr 6 Tube is an excellent option for a variety of industrial and commercial requirements.
